链路聚合
链路聚合
技术背景:1、网络中某些链路承载的流量非常大,链路带宽存在瓶颈 2、链路存在单点故障(冗余性低);通过以太网链路聚合技术,能够将多条以太网链路进行捆绑,捆绑之后的聚合链路不仅仅在带宽上有了提升,还同时提供了负载分担及链路冗余。
链路聚合(Link Aggregation)是将一组物理接口捆绑在一起作为一个逻辑接口来增加带宽的方法,又称为多接口负载均衡组(Load Sharing Group)或链路聚合组(Link Aggregation Group),相关的标准协议请参考IEEE802.3ad;通过两台设备之间建立链路聚合组,可以提供更高的通讯带宽和更高的可靠性。链路聚合不仅仅为设备间通信提供了冗余保护,而且不需要对硬件进行升级。
工作方式:手工负载均衡
- 手工负载分担模式允许在聚合组中手工加入多个成员接口,所有的接口均处于转发状态,分担负载的流量。S3900支持的负载均衡分担方式包括目的MAC、源MAC、源MAC异或目的MAC、源IP、目的IP、源IP异或目的IP和增强模式
- Eth-Trunk的创建、成员接口的加入都需要手工配置完成,没有LACP协议报文的参与
- 手工负载分担模式通常应用在对端设备不支持LACP协议的情况下。(LACP:Link Agregation Control Protocol)
工作方式:静态LACP
- 静态LACP(Static LACP)模式是一种利用LACP协议进行聚合参数协商、确定活动接口和非活动接口的链路聚合方式。该模式下,需手工创建Eth-Trunk,手工加入Eth-Trunk成员接口,由LACP协议协商确定活动接口和非活动接口。
- 静态LACP模式也称为M∶N模式。这种方式同时可以实现链路负载分担和链路冗余备份的双重功能。在链路聚合组中M条链路处于活动状态,这些链路负责转发数据并进行负载分担,另外N条链路处于非活动状态作为备份链路,不转发数据。当M条链路中有链路出现故障时,系统会从N条备份链路中选择优先级最高的接替出现故障的链路,同时这条替换故障链路的备份链路状态变为活动状态开始转发数据。
- 静态LACP模式与手工负载分担模式的主要区别为:静态LACP模式有备份链路,而手工负载分担模式所有成员接口均处于转发状态,分担负载流量。
- 和静态LACP模式相对应的还包括动态LACP模式。动态LACP模式的链路聚合,从Eth-Trunk的创建到加入成员接口都不需要人工的干预,由LACP协议自动协商完成。虽然这种方式对于用户来说很简单,但由于这种方式过于灵活,不便于管理,所以S9300上不支持动态LACP模式链路聚合。
实验
手工负载分担模式
静态LACP模式
转载请注明来源,欢迎对文章中的引用来源进行考证,欢迎指出任何有错误或不够清晰的表达。可以在下面评论区评论,也可以邮件至 2924854739@qq.com
文章标题:链路聚合
本文作者:DROBP
发布时间:2019-11-07, 19:52:42
最后更新:2019-11-07, 19:55:30
原始链接:https://DROBP.github.io/2019/11/07/链路聚合/版权声明: "署名-非商用-相同方式共享 4.0" 转载请保留原文链接及作者。